WebTo cut 24-inch porcelain tile using an angle grinder, follow the steps below: Mark the shape that you are intending to cut on both sides of the tile using a marker or electrician’s tape. Using the angle grinder, cautiously follow the outline of the shape with very little pressure to achieve the cleanest cut.

WebStep 1: Lay the paving stones along the curve one by one, then mark a line on your paver where the cuts need to be. Step 2: Set the marked paver up on supports (other pavers will work well) with the marked area over the space between the supports. This gives your blade a clear path. WebWhen cutting a contraction joint be sure to calculate the appropriate depth the saw cut needs to be. A true contraction joint, or control joint, is ¼ of the slabs overall thickness. For example, if your slab is 4 inches thick, the control joint needs to be cut 1 inch deep.
